Aβ (1 μm) increases p38 MAPK/JNK phosphorylation in cortical slices. A, The plot represents averaged phospho-p38 MAPK levels measured using ELISA and expressed as unit/total content of p38 MAPK protein. Tissue levels of phospho-p38 MAPK after slices perfusion with 1 μm Aβ(1-42) were significantly higher with respect to control vehicle-treated slices (*p < 0.05 vs control vehicle) both before and after LFS. Selective deficiency of RAGE signaling in microglia (DNMSR) and complete inactivation of RAGE with anti-RAGE IgG did not modify basal level of phospho-p38 MAPK (p > 0.05 vs control vehicle). Blockade of RAGE was able to prevent Aβ-induced increase of phospho-p38 MAPK (p < 0.05 vs slices treated with Aβ alone), even if the increase induced by LFS was still present. p38 MAPK activation by Aβ was also significantly reduced in slices treated with IL-1Ra (p < 0.05 vs Aβ alone) and in slices treated with the JNK inhibitor SP600125 (p < 0.05 vs Aβ alone). B, The plot represents averaged phospho-JNK levels measured using ELISA and expressed as unit/total content of JNK protein. Elevated phospho-JNK levels were increased by 1 μm Aβ treatment (*p < 0.05 vs control vehicle) but not by LFS. Deficiency of RAGE signaling in microglia (DNMSR) and complete inactivation of RAGE with anti-RAGE IgG did not modify basal level of phospho-JNK both before and after LFS (p > 0.05 vs control vehicle). Blockade of RAGE was able to prevent Aβ-induced increase of phospho-JNK (p < 0.05 vs slices treated with Aβ alone). Phospho-JNK level after 1 μm Aβ treatment was also significantly reduced in slices treated with IL-1Ra (p < 0.05 vs Aβ alone). C, The plot represents average IL-1β levels (in picograms per milliliter) in EC slices; IL-1β level was significantly increased in cortical slices exposed to 1 μm Aβ for 10 min, whereas inhibition of JNK (SP600125) but not of p38 MAPK (SB203580) prevented Aβ effect and IL-1β levels were comparable with control values (p > 0.05 vs control). Error bars indicate SEM.
